Did Honeywell buy Ademco?
Ademco was a security company that was bought out by Honeywell in 2000. Much of the security equipment that was sold under the Ademco banner was then sold as Honeywell equipment. Some of the older Honeywell equipment can still be found with the Ademco label.

Is the Honeywell Vista 20p a step up from the 15p?
The Ademco Honeywell Vista 20P is a step up from the 15P model and can handle more zones, more user codes, features 2 partition areas and has a larger event memory among numerous other upgrades. If playback doesn’t begin shortly, try restarting your device.
Where is the red jumper on the Ademco Vista 20p?
The Ademco Vista 20P has the ability to supervise the bell connection, so you’ll get a trouble beeping at the keypad if the siren wire is cut. To enable this feature, cut the red jumper on the circuit board; it’s located just above the terminal strip on the left end.

What do the Honeywell Vista 20p and 21ip do?
The Honeywell VISTA 15P, 20P and 21iP are hardwired security systems that can each serve as the central hub for a user’s security setup. Since these systems do not come with their own display screen, a user may feel somewhat intimidated when working with one of these panels.
